在PHP中,当使用数据库插入数据时,如果插入操作成功,数据将会被正确地插入到数据库中。但是,如果插入操作失败,插入的数据是否重复取决于具体的数据库表结构和数据约束设置。
一般情况下,数据库表可以通过设置主键、唯一约束或者索引来确保数据的唯一性。如果插入的数据违反了这些约束,数据库会拒绝插入操作并返回错误信息。此时,插入的数据将被视为重复数据。
在处理插入数据时,可以通过以下几种方式来避免插入重复数据:
综上所述,PHP在插入数据时,如果插入操作失败,插入的数据是否重复取决于数据库表结构和数据约束设置。为了避免插入重复数据,可以使用数据库的唯一约束、主键、索引或者在插入之前进行查询等方式。
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云